The Problem With Plastic Litter Trays

Plastic may be inexpensive, but it has a major flaw when used as a litter tray: it absorbs odours and bacteria over time.

Most plastic litter boxes are made from porous polymers. Although they appear smooth, under a microscope the surface contains tiny imperfections that can trap:

  • Urine residue
  • Odour-causing bacteria
  • Litter dust and organic waste

Over time, these contaminants penetrate the surface of the plastic. Even after washing, the smell often lingers inside the material itself.

This is why many cat owners notice:

  • Their litter tray smells again shortly after cleaning
  • The plastic becomes discoloured
  • The tray develops a permanent “cat smell”

Eventually, many people replace their plastic tray every year or two simply because the smell never truly disappears.

Why Stainless Steel Solves the Problem

Stainless steel behaves very differently from plastic.

High-quality stainless steel is non-porous, meaning liquids, bacteria and odours cannot penetrate the material. Instead, waste sits on the surface where it can be easily removed during routine scooping.

This creates several major advantages.

1. Stainless Steel Doesn’t Absorb Odours

Unlike plastic, stainless steel does not trap smells. Urine and bacteria cannot soak into the material, so the tray does not develop that permanent litter box odour over time.

This keeps both the tray and your home smelling fresher.

2. A Much More Hygienic Surface

Because stainless steel is non-porous, it’s naturally more hygienic. Bacteria have fewer places to hide, making it easier to maintain a clean litter area for your cat.

4. Built to Last a Lifetime

Plastic litter trays eventually degrade. Scratches from claws create grooves that trap bacteria and smells, and the plastic becomes increasingly difficult to clean.

Stainless steel is far more durable. It resists scratching, staining and warping, which means a well-made tray can last for the entire lifetime of your cat.

5. A Better Experience for Your Cat

Cats are naturally very clean animals. A litter tray that retains smells can discourage use, especially for sensitive cats.

Because stainless steel stays fresher and cleaner, many cats appear more comfortable using it.

The Environmental Benefits of Stainless Steel Litter Boxes

Another often-overlooked advantage of stainless steel litter boxes is their environmental impact.

A Tray That Doesn’t Need Replacing

Plastic litter trays typically need replacing every few years because they become scratched, stained, and permanently smelly. Over the lifetime of a cat, many owners may throw away 10 or more plastic trays and they all go to landfill.

Stainless steel is far more durable and resistant to wear. A well-made tray can last for many years and stainless steel is recyclable meaning it won't end up in landfill.

Choosing a stainless steel tray is therefore a simple way to reduce unnecessary plastic waste in your home.
